While more than 80,000 requests for illegal horse racing sites have been reported and closed in the past six years, only 60,000 have led to actual closures, which need to be improved.

According to the data received by Chung Hee-yong, a member of the People's Power, from the Korea Racing Association, between 2019 and September this year, there were a total of 81,042 requests for illegal horse racing sites to be reported and closed, and 61,064 sites were actually closed.

It is explained that there are physical limitations in the process of closing the Korea Communications Standards Commission through reporting or self-detection, checking whether the Korea Communications Standards Commission is illegal, and closing it.

Lawmaker Chung stressed that failure to properly crack down on illegal horse racing sites could cause social harm as well as individuals, and that damage to the public should be prevented by strengthening the expertise of the crackdown personnel and expanding the cooperation system with investigative agencies.
